在这个数字化迅猛发展的时代,越来越多的人开始关注如何管理自己的数字资产。而以太坊作为一种主流的加密货币,其钱包的创建和管理无疑是这一领域中的关键所在。想象一下,如果你能够快速而高效地批量创建以太坊钱包,将会为你的资产管理带来多大的便利!正如我们常说的:“一日之计在于晨”,而对于加密资产的管理,今天的准备将决定明天的轻松。
在开始批量创建以太坊钱包之前,首先需要选择一个合适的工具。现如今,有许多在线和离线工具供你选择。例如,MetaMask、MyEtherWallet等都提供了创建钱包的功能。然而,批量创建钱包则更需要专业的工具,如一些开源的命令行工具,能够帮助你批量生成钱包地址及私钥。
在选择工具时,请务必考虑安全性与易用性。有句话说得好:“便宜没好货”,选择一个口碑良好的工具,可以为你节省不少麻烦。
在批量创建以太坊钱包之前,了解以太坊钱包的工作原理是十分必要的。以太坊钱包主要由公钥和私钥组成,公钥相当于你的地址,而私钥则是你控制该地址资金的凭证。无论何时,千万不要将私钥泄露给他人,正如谚语所说:“防人之心不可无”。
下面,我们将以一个开源的工具为例,展示批量创建以太坊钱包的步骤。在这个例子中,我们使用Node.js,前提是你的电脑上已经安装了此开发环境。
1. 创建一个新目录并进入该目录;
2. 初始化Node.js项目:npm init -y;
3. 安装 web3.js库:npm install web3;
4. 创建一个新的JavaScript文件,例如createWallets.js;
5. 在文件中编写生成钱包的代码。
这些步骤就像是“开门见山”,非常直观。接下来,我们将展示如何用代码生成多个钱包。
在我们的createWallets.js文件中,可以利用web3.js库来生成以太坊钱包。代码示例如下:
const Web3 = require('web3');
const web3 = new Web3();
const generateWallets = (num) => {
const wallets = [];
for (let i = 0; i < num; i ) {
const wallet = web3.eth.accounts.create();
wallets.push({
address: wallet.address,
privateKey: wallet.privateKey,
});
}
return wallets;
};
const num = 10; // 生成10个钱包
console.log(generateWallets(num));
这个代码片段展示了如何生成指定数量的以太坊钱包。每一个钱包都有其独特的公钥和私钥,就像“每个硬币都有两面”一样,确保你的私钥安全是至关重要的。
生成钱包后,下一步是如何安全地存储这些信息。当涉及到私钥时,确保它们的安全存储是绝对必要的。可以选择将信息保存在加密文件中,或是使用安全的硬件钱包进行存储。正所谓:“将心比心”,我们也应该对我们的资产负责。
此外,做个备份也非常关键。倘若丢失了私钥,便代表着这些钱包与其资产的永久失去,这就像“失之毫厘,谬以千里”。所以,你可以考虑使用一些专门的密码管理工具来保存备份。
在这里,我们分享一个实际的操作案例。假设你是一位数字货币投资者,计划为多个项目分配资金。按照上述步骤,你成功批量创建了多个以太坊钱包,从而可以更加轻松地对资产进行管理。
在项目初期,你可以将小额资金分散到这些钱包中,这样就能有效降低风险。并且在每一个钱包之间转账的过程也能够帮助你了解不同资产的流动情况,做到“心中有数”。
批量创建以太坊钱包的过程并不难,但需要我们认真对待每个环节。从选择工具,到理解钱包机制,再到生成钱包和安全存储,每一步都不能松懈。就如同我们常说的:“千里之行,始于足下”,每一份小心和努力最终都将换来资产管理的高效与安全。
在这个数字资产频繁变动的时代,通过批量创建以太坊钱包,你将掌握资产管理的新利器。不论你是投资新手还是资深玩家,都能在这过程中,找到适合自己的管理方式,轻松应对不断变化的市场。
最后,希望这篇文章不仅能为你提供切实可行的步骤,也能启发你在数字资产管理中的思考与探索。别忘了,懂得管理资产的人,才是时代的赢家!
leave a reply